Putah Creek Fly Fishing Report

Rob Russell reports on 4.12.18

Putah


    Flows have been mostly stable over the last week and fishing has been good!  200 cfs is a great flow for fishing and wading the many runs and pockets of Putah Creek.  Fishing has been best on the warmer days, directly corresponding to a strong midge hatch in the morning.       Smaller streamers have been producing as well.

Owyhee Fly Fishing Report

Cory Godnell reports on 4.12.18

Owyhee

The Skwala’s on the Owyhee are starting to wind down. If we are lucky, the bugs will stick around for another week or so. The fishing this spring on the Owyhee has been one of the more consistent springs we’ve had, with the exception of the weather mudding up the river for part of one day. Truckee River Fly Fishing Report

Matt Koles reports on 4.12.18

Truckee

Lots of water in the ole Truckee River.

Flows got big Saturday morning, about 6,200 cfs or so. Not as big as last January when they crested at just over 9000k here in the Hirsch. They’re back down to about 4,300 k or something like that now. Kinda just like last year, high water and really good fishing. Yes, I said really good fishing.

California Delta Fly Fishing Report

Bryce Tedford reports on 4.12.18

Delta

Delta Striper fishing is challenging with dirty water from recent rains throughout much of the Delta. Recently I am averaging 10-15 fish to 5lbs, the trick has been to find reasonable clean water that is holding feeding fish.

Eastern Sierra Fly Fishing Report

Jim Stimson reports on 4.12.18

Eastern Sierra

We had LOTS of rain on Saturday. I believe the snow line was above 11K which made many of the freestone rivers blow out. The West Walker crested at over 1600 cfs with all of the snowmelt and runoff from the rain. Everything is settling to back to normal flows and now we are left with lots of wind, my favorite.
